The Greening Value Chain Programme (GVC) has been successfully rolled out by Kossan Rubber Industries (“KOSSAN”) together with its climate solutions partner, Pantas Software (“PANTAS”). This programme was previously launched by Bank Negara Malaysian (“BNM”) in conjunction with the Finance Day at COP-27, in Egypt[1]. The event was held in attendance of Suhaimi Ali (Assistant Governor of Bank Negara Malaysia), Tan Sri Dato’ Lim Kuang Sia (Group Managing Director & CEO of Kossan Rubber Industries Berhad) and Max Lee (Chief Executive Officer, Pantas Software Sdn Bhd).

The programme aims to assist and incentivise carbon emission management among KOSSAN’s small medium enterprise (SME) suppliers, making them the strategic SME suppliers of KOSSAN. This programme enables these suppliers to access BNM’s Low Carbon Transition Facility (LCTF) of RM2 billion to fund SMEs’ working capital or capital expenditures related to low-carbon practices at an affordable rate.

To achieve this, PANTAS, a Malaysia-based climate-tech solution, will assist the SMEs to begin measuring GHG emissions and report on sustainability indicators in a consistent and efficient manner to help achieve national carbon reduction targets. The SMEs will receive free access to carbon accounting software solutions developed by PANTAS along with training and consultation services provided by GVC service provider partners such as Malaysia Green Technology and Climate Change Corporation (“MGTC”), Credit Guarantee Corporation Malaysia Berhad (“CGC”), British Standards Institution (“BSI”), and AmBank Berhad (“AmBank”) to kickstart their carbon management journey. The programme is supported by the Joint Committee of Climate Change (“JC3”) which is co-chaired by BNM and Securities Commission Malaysia.

As Tan Sri Dato’ Lim Kuang Sia, Group Managing Director and CEO of KOSSAN said in his speech, “This programme is a great representation of KOSSAN’s values. As part of KOSSAN’s L.I.V.E Sustainability Policy, we believe that to succeed in our sustainability journey, we need to strengthen our partnership and collaboration. This programme is a win-win-win relationship for our suppliers and KOSSAN, which also benefits the environment. This is one example of our commitment to creating shared values with our partners because we believe that our sustainability journey is a path to take together”.

PANTAS CEO and Co-founder, Max Lee stated, “We believe that an integrated software solution, relevant training and awareness are essential to get SMEs onboard KOSSAN’s sustainability efforts to ensure a just transition. Apart from assisting SMEs in measuring and disclosing the relevant climate data, PANTAS will also work with partners to help SMEs set and achieve carbon reduction targets.”

Following the GVC programme rollout, PANTAS and the selected service provider partners will hold regional training sessions to equip SME suppliers with valuable insights into climate change, including the importance and methods of carbon management and reporting. Additionally, SMEs will gain an in-depth understanding of the assurance process and access to climate-related financing products. The first training session will be held on March 21st, 2023 in Lanai Kijang, Kuala Lumpur.

About GVC Programme

The GVC programme is an initiative by Bank Negara Malaysia together with the GVC strategic partners, which was announced at the COP-27 conference in Egypt in conjunction with Finance Day on 9 November 2022. The programme is envisaged to help SMEs begin their journey in sustainability reporting, to tackle climate change and reduce the nation’s carbon footprint. This programme incentivises and assists Malaysian SMEs in implementing impactful, long-term change to green their operations and benefit from the technical advisories and software tools from services provider partners and climate transition financing from the Low Carbon Transition Facility (LCTF) by Bank Negara Malaysia. About KOSSAN

KOSSAN is one of the largest manufacturers of disposable gloves in the world and one of the largest technical rubber product manufacturers in Malaysia. With its long-term sustainable growth model, KOSSAN continues to forge solid partnerships and strategic client relations and remains committed to serving the needs, particularly of the healthcare, cleanroom and safety sectors for the Gloves division, and in industries such as automotive, infrastructure, marine, aviation, rail and mining for the Technical Rubber Products division.

About Pantas

Pantas Software is a Malaysian climate-tech startup that provides companies with end-to-end climate solutions to calculate, manage and disclose their carbon emissions. The proprietary AI-enabled software includes a customised climate data collection tool, along with error detection and prevention features to produce an actionable climate plan based on international standards. Pantas also provides financial institutions and institutional investors with climate due diligence solutions to manage climate investment risk.
